Hardware Design Engineer, Optical Transceiver & High-Speed Networking
Overview
5+ years of board-level hardware design experience for high-speed optical transceivers. Own end-to-end hardware development from architecture through release for 1.2T and 1.6T platforms. Collaborate with RF, firmware, mechanical, PCB layout, and manufacturing teams to deliver reliable, high-performance solutions. This role emphasizes rigorous design reviews, validation, and cross-functional teamwork in a hybrid on-site environment.
What You'll Do9
- 1Build electrical architecture and detailed hardware designs for high-speed optical platforms to meet performance and reliability targets
- 2Design and review PADS schematics from scratch and oversee PCB layout to ensure intent is preserved
- 3Develop power distribution and high-performance power supply architectures for board-level designs
- 4Validate signal integrity and power integrity through cross-functional testing and design reviews
- 5Own board-level verification and root-cause analysis across hardware and system levels
- 6Mentor and collaborate with RF, firmware, mechanical, and manufacturing teams throughout the lifecycle
- 7Lead design reviews and present rationale and analysis results to stakeholders
- 8Support simulation and modeling using SPICE and CST to optimize performance
- 9Ensure compliance with customer specifications and contribute to design verification strategies
